AM&A’s Warehouse Lofts – 369 Washington Street, Buffalo, NY 14203 • 1 bed • 1 bath • Unfurnished • 765 square feet • $1,250 per month • Available mid July • Security deposit equals one month's rent ($1,250) • Next door to the beautiful Hotel & Apartments at the Buffalo Lafayette (which contains two restaurants and bars and Public Espresso to get your coffee fix) • Close proximity to the Medical Campus (Children’s Hospital, Buffalo General & Roswell Park) First Niagara Center, Canal Side, Ellicott Street (restaurant row), the 33 and 190 and the subway line (for quick access to downtown, Medical Campus and University of Buffalo’s South Campus) • Central heat and central air conditioning in unit • Hardwood floors, granite countertops with stainless steel appliances (gas stove and dishwasher!) • Water, trash and recycling are paid by the landlord • Washers & dryers (coin operated) are on premise • Monthly parking in Buffalo Civic Auto Ramps (BCAR) Adam’s Ramp located just across the street from the building with monthly pricing of $87 per month for 24-hour parking access • Cat or dog up to 20 pounds welcome (no pet deposit required) • Gas & electric (for heat, cooking and A/C), cable and internet are paid by the tenant. Gas & electric bills are modest averaging between $90 - $125 per month combined • See pictures of the unit (previously decorated by another tenant) with the unit's floor plan below YouTube Video URL -- Keys
